Gu Wang is a scholar working on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ition, Control and Systems Engineering and Aerospace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Gu Wang has authored 15 papers receiving a total of 627 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 10 papers in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ition, 9 papers in Control and Systems Engineering and 7 papers in Aerospace Engineering. Recurrent topics in Gu Wang’s work include Robot Manipulation and Learning (8 papers), Robotics and Sensor-Based Localization (7 papers) and Human Pose and Action Recognition (6 papers). Gu Wang is often cited by papers focused on Robot Manipulation and Learning (8 papers), Robotics and Sensor-Based Localization (7 papers) and Human Pose and Action Recognition (6 papers). Gu Wang collaborates with scholars based in China, United States and Germany. Gu Wang's co-authors include Xiangyang Ji, Zhigang Li, Federico Tombari, Fabian Manhardt, Yu Xiang, Yi Li, Dieter Fox, Nassir Navab, Yuhang Jiang and Zhigang Li and has published in prestigious journals such as IEEE Transactions on Pattern Analysis and Machine Intelligence, The Science of The Total Environment and International Journal of Computer Vision.
